Are you seriously considering retiring to the Caribbean, but unsure which country is right for you?Sunshine, beaches, and a slower pace of life are appealing-but the reality of retirement abroad is far more complex. Immigration rules, healthcare access, cost of living, infrastructure, safety, and cultural differences vary dramatically from one Caribbean country to another. Choosing poorly can turn a lifelong dream into an expensive and stressful mistake. Immigrating and Retiring to the Caribbean: Which Country to Choose? Pros and Cons is a comprehensive, practical, and realistic guide written for retirees and near-retirees who want clarity before commitment.What This Book CoversThis in-depth guide examines all 13 sovereign Caribbean countries, each in its own dedicated chapter, including: History, political system, economy, and cultureImmigration and residency options for retireesCost of living and financial preparationHealthcare systems and medical realitiesHousing, transportation, food, and daily lifeStrengths, weaknesses, and trade-offs of each destinationThe book focuses on long-term living, not tourism or short stays.A Practical Guide-Not a Sales PitchUnlike many relocation or expat guides, this book avoids hype and fantasy. It does not promise paradise. Instead, it helps you answer the questions that truly matter: Which Caribbean countries are safest for retirees?Where is healthcare reliable as you age?Which islands are affordable-and which only appear so?How difficult is residency or long-term stay approval?What lifestyle compromises are unavoidable?Which destinations fit your budget, health needs, and temperament?You'll find decision frameworks, comparison matrices, realistic monthly budgets, and step-by-step planning guidance designed to prevent costly mistakes.Who This Book Is ForThis book is ideal for: Retirees considering moving to the CaribbeanFuture retirees planning aheadExpats seeking long-term residence abroadReaders looking for honest, non-promotional analysisIt is especially valuable if you want to compare countries objectively before relocating.Why This Book Is DifferentCovers all 13 independent Caribbean nationsWritten in clear, accessible prose for non-specialistsFocuses on retirement realities, not vacation appealAddresses healthcare, aging, and long-term sustainabilityIncludes appendices with documents, budgets, and planning toolsThis is not a book about escaping life-it is a book about choosing wisely how to live it.
